In October 2024, a child was brought to medical attention after parents noticed significant depressions on both sides of the rib cage, which progressively worsened. The child was diagnosed with bilateral Pectus Excavatum by the Department of Thoracic Surgery at Guangdong Maternal and Child Health Hospital. Physicians recommended conservative treatment.
The family initially tried standard over‑the‑counter vacuum bells, but encountered frequent air leakage, size mismatch, and complex operation. After three months, no visible improvement was observed.
In January 2025, the child was referred to EMK for evaluation and personalized treatment. EMK developed a custom dual-vacuum bell therapy plan:
3D chest reconstruction based on scan data
Custom‑designed dual vacuum bells tailored to the patient's anatomy
Smart constant pressure device + remote monitoring mini‑program
This approach fundamentally addressed the limitations of generic devices in fit and operational efficiency.
According to records from the EMK Chest Wall Orthotic Management System (doctor portal), after five months of treatment:
Average treatment pressure increased from 8 kPa to 15 kPa
Average daily wear time: 144 minutes
Follow‑up measurements showed marked chest contour improvement:
| Measurement | Before Treatment | After 5 Months | Improvement |
|---|---|---|---|
| Left Depression Area | |||
| – Transverse diameter | 61.03 mm | 43.90 mm | ↓ 17.13 mm |
| – Longitudinal diameter | 61.54 mm | 58.13 mm | ↓ 3.41 mm |
| – Depression depth | 8.02 mm | 5.66 mm | ↓ 2.36 mm |
| Right Depression Area | |||
| – Transverse diameter | 74.04 mm | 62.70 mm | ↓ 11.34 mm |
| – Longitudinal diameter | 74.88 mm | 66.78 mm | ↓ 8.10 mm |
| – Depression depth | 10.56 mm | 7.94 mm | ↓ 2.62 mm |

EMK's newly introduced dual‑vacuum bell therapy achieves deep integration of personalization and intelligence, forming a more scientific, safe, and convenient non‑surgical correction system for chest wall deformities — especially suited for complex bilateral pectus excavatum.
Key technical features include:
| Feature | Description |
|---|---|
| 1. Precision 3D Modeling & Customized Treatment | Reconstructs the patient's chest model using 3D scan or CT data. Dual vacuum bells are custom‑designed based on the morphological differences between left and right depressions, enabling simultaneous bilateral fit and correction — significantly improving treatment efficiency and stability. |
| 2. Smart Constant Pressure Control System | Built‑in high‑sensitivity pressure monitoring module automatically detects suction status and rapidly compensates for pressure drops caused by air leakage, maintaining stable therapeutic pressure and minimizing efficacy fluctuations. |
| 3. Smart Pressure Ramp Algorithm | Segmented pressure control with differentiated ramp‑up rates across pressure ranges achieves gradual negative pressure increase, effectively reducing initial discomfort and improving treatment compliance — ideal for children and sensitive patients. |
| 4. Personalized Pressure Protection | Maximum treatment pressure can be individually set according to patient age, body type, and chest structure, preventing over‑pressurization risks and ensuring dynamic balance between efficacy and safety. |
| 5. Smart Data Storage & Bluetooth Sync | Supports real‑time data upload via Bluetooth; automatically stores data locally when offline and seamlessly synchronizes upon reconnection — ensuring data continuity and integrity for long‑term tracking and evaluation. |
| 6. Remote Monitoring via WeChat | Parents can track their child's usage duration, pressure levels, and treatment trends in real time through a WeChat Mini Program. Data can be shared with physicians or other family members, enabling remote treatment adjustments and collaborative care. |
